News summary

Kansas City Chiefs tight end Travis Kelce was fined $14,491 by the NFL for making an "obscene gesture" during the Week 2 game against the Philadelphia Eagles, where he mimed juggling his own testicles after a 23-yard reception. The gesture, caught on camera and widely circulated on social media, was ruled as unsportsmanlike conduct, marking Kelce's third fine since 2021. The Chiefs lost the game 20-17, with Kelce's mistake in the fourth quarter leading to an interception and a touchdown for the Eagles, contributing to the team's 0-2 start, its worst since 2014. Kelce's frustration with the team's performance was evident during the game, and former Chiefs player Shannon Sharpe criticized his play and attitude on his podcast. The incident gained additional attention due to Kelce's high-profile relationship and engagement with singer Taylor Swift. Despite the fine and criticism, Kelce has the option to appeal, and the team looks to recover as they prepare for upcoming games.
